The 226570 isn't just a watch; it's a statement. Its 42mm Oyster case, crafted from 904L stainless steel, offers exceptional durability and resistance to scratches and corrosion. This robust construction is a hallmark of Rolex, reflecting their commitment to creating timepieces that can withstand the rigors of even the most demanding environments. The iconic Oyster bracelet, with its seamlessly integrated links and comfortable clasp, further enhances the watch's wearability and reinforces its robust character.
The watch's signature feature, however, is its striking polar white dial. This clean, minimalist design provides exceptional legibility, even in low-light conditions. The contrasting black 24-hour hand, a crucial element for discerning day from night in challenging conditions, sits prominently alongside the hour, minute, and seconds hands. The luminescent markers, ensuring readability in darkness, are another testament to the watch's functionality. The date window, subtly placed at 3 o'clock, completes the dial's understated elegance. This clean and functional design philosophy perfectly embodies the spirit of exploration and adventure that the Explorer II line represents.
The heart of the 226570 beats with the caliber 3187, a self-winding mechanical movement entirely developed and manufactured by Rolex. This movement, known for its precision and reliability, boasts a power reserve of approximately 48 hours, ensuring consistent timekeeping even when the watch isn't worn. The movement's certification by the Swiss Official Chronometer Testing Institute (COSC) guarantees its exceptional accuracy, further solidifying the watch's reputation for quality and precision.
